NutzCN Logo
问答 在Linux下启动Tomcat一直卡在 Save object 'conf' to [app]
发布于 3066天前 作者 Longitude 2759 次浏览 复制 上一个帖子 下一个帖子
标签: ioc

Nov 26, 2015 1:26:27 PM org.apache.catalina.startup.Catalina load
INFO: Initialization processed in 4953 ms
Nov 26, 2015 1:26:28 PM org.apache.catalina.core.StandardService startInternal
INFO: Starting service Catalina
Nov 26, 2015 1:26:28 PM org.apache.catalina.core.StandardEngine startInternal
INFO: Starting Servlet Engine: Apache Tomcat/7.0.65
Nov 26, 2015 1:26:28 PM org.apache.catalina.startup.HostConfig deployWAR
INFO: Deploying web application archive /apache-tomcat-7.0.65/webapps/move1.war
Nov 26, 2015 1:26:36 PM org.apache.catalina.startup.TldConfig execute
INFO: At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.
2015-11-26 13:26:37.239 WARN [localhost-startStop-1] !!You are using default SystemLog! Don't use it in Production environment!!
2015-11-26 13:26:37.251 INFO [localhost-startStop-1] Nutz is licensed under the Apache License, Version 2.0 .
Report bugs : https://github.com/nutzam/nutz/issues
2015-11-26 13:26:37.281 INFO [localhost-startStop-1] NutFilter[calensoft] starting ...
2015-11-26 13:26:37.935 DEBUG [localhost-startStop-1] Locations for Scans:
[JarResourceLocation [jarPath=/apache-tomcat-7.0.65/bin/bootstrap.jar], FileSystemResourceLocation [root=/apache-tomcat-7.0.65/bin], FileSystemResourceLocation [root=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/classes],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/nutz-1.b.53.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/bin/tomcat-juli.jar]]
2015-11-26 13:26:39.495 DEBUG [localhost-startStop-1] Locations for Scans:
[J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/quartz-2.2.1.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/bin/bootstrap.jar], FileSystemResourceLocation [root=/apache-tomcat-7.0.65/bin],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/commons-net-3.3.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/druid-1.0.13.jar], FileSystemResourceLocation [root=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/classes],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/mysql-connector-java-5.1.7-bin.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/slf4j-api-1.6.6.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/lombok-1.1.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/webapps/move1/WEB-INF/lib/nutz-1.b.53.jar], JarResourceLocation [jarPath=/apache-tomcat-7.0.65/bin/tomcat-juli.jar]]
2015-11-26 13:26:39.504 DEBUG [localhost-startStop-1] MainModule: <cn.calensoft.MainModule>
2015-11-26 13:26:39.628 DEBUG [localhost-startStop-1] Loading by class org.nutz.mvc.impl.NutLoading
2015-11-26 13:26:39.652 INFO [localhost-startStop-1] Nutz Version : 1.b.53
2015-11-26 13:26:39.653 INFO [localhost-startStop-1] Nutz.Mvc[calensoft] is initializing ...
2015-11-26 13:26:39.663 DEBUG [localhost-startStop-1] Web Container Information:
2015-11-26 13:26:39.775 DEBUG [localhost-startStop-1] - Default Charset : UTF-8
2015-11-26 13:26:39.778 DEBUG [localhost-startStop-1] - Current . path : /apache-tomcat-7.0.65/bin/.
2015-11-26 13:26:39.779 DEBUG [localhost-startStop-1] - Java Version : 1.7.0_03
2015-11-26 13:26:39.783 DEBUG [localhost-startStop-1] - File separator : /
2015-11-26 13:26:39.784 DEBUG [localhost-startStop-1] - Timezone : PRC
2015-11-26 13:26:39.786 DEBUG [localhost-startStop-1] - OS : Linux amd64
2015-11-26 13:26:39.795 DEBUG [localhost-startStop-1] - ServerInfo : Apache Tomcat/7.0.65
2015-11-26 13:26:39.798 DEBUG [localhost-startStop-1] - Servlet API : 3.0
2015-11-26 13:26:39.799 DEBUG [localhost-startStop-1] - ContextPath : /move1
2015-11-26 13:26:39.814 DEBUG [localhost-startStop-1] MainModule: <cn.calensoft.MainModule>
2015-11-26 13:26:39.815 DEBUG [localhost-startStop-1] >> app.root = /apache-tomcat-7.0.65/webapps/move1
2015-11-26 13:26:40.301 DEBUG [localhost-startStop-1] Using 91 castor for Castors
2015-11-26 13:26:40.342 DEBUG [localhost-startStop-1] @IocBy(type=org.nutz.mvc.ioc.provider.ComboIocProvider, args=["*org.nutz.ioc.loader.json.JsonLoader", "ioc/", "*org.nutz.ioc.loader.annotation.AnnotationIocLoader", "cn.calensoft"],init=[])
2015-11-26 13:26:40.451 DEBUG [localhost-startStop-1] Found 1 resource by src( ioc/ ) , regex( ^(.+[.])(js|json)$ )
2015-11-26 13:26:40.452 DEBUG [localhost-startStop-1] loading ioc js config from [dao.js]
2015-11-26 13:26:40.473 DEBUG [localhost-startStop-1] Loaded 3 bean define from path=[ioc/] --> [dataSource, dao, conf]
2015-11-26 13:26:40.565 DEBUG [localhost-startStop-1] Found 33 resource by src( cn/calensoft/ ) , regex( ^.+[.]class$ )
2015-11-26 13:26:40.727 DEBUG [localhost-startStop-1] Found a Class with Ioc-Annotation : class cn.calensoft.service.Move1TaskService
2015-11-26 13:26:40.873 DEBUG [localhost-startStop-1] Found a Class with Ioc-Annotation : class cn.calensoft.service.HeartbeatService
2015-11-26 13:26:40.925 DEBUG [localhost-startStop-1] Found a Class with Ioc-Annotation : class cn.calensoft.service.QuartzService
2015-11-26 13:26:40.949 INFO [localhost-startStop-1] Scan complete ! Found 3 classes in 1 base-packages!
beans = ["quartzService", "move1TaskService", "heartbeatService"]
2015-11-26 13:26:40.972 INFO [localhost-startStop-1] NutIoc init begin ...
2015-11-26 13:26:40.982 INFO [localhost-startStop-1] ... NutIoc init complete
2015-11-26 13:26:40.988 DEBUG [localhost-startStop-1] MainModule: <cn.calensoft.MainModule>
2015-11-26 13:26:41.20 INFO [localhost-startStop-1] Build URL mapping by org.nutz.mvc.impl.UrlMappingImpl ...
2015-11-26 13:26:41.33 DEBUG [localhost-startStop-1] @Views(DefaultViewMaker)
2015-11-26 13:26:41.76 DEBUG [localhost-startStop-1] @ChainBy(org.nutz.mvc.impl.NutActionChainMaker)
2015-11-26 13:26:41.113 DEBUG [localhost-startStop-1] module class location 'file:/apache-tomcat-7.0.65/webapps/move1/WEB-INF/classes/'
2015-11-26 13:26:41.120 DEBUG [localhost-startStop-1] > scan 'cn.calensoft'
2015-11-26 13:26:41.187 DEBUG [localhost-startStop-1] Found 33 resource by src( cn/calensoft/ ) , regex( ^.+[.]class$ )
2015-11-26 13:26:41.223 DEBUG [localhost-startStop-1] >> add 'cn.calensoft.service.Move1TaskService'
2015-11-26 13:26:41.288 INFO [localhost-startStop-1] Optional processor class not found, disabled : org.nutz.integration.shiro.NutShiroProcessor
2015-11-26 13:26:41.327 INFO [localhost-startStop-1] Optional processor class not found, disabled : org.nutz.plugins.validation.ValidationProcessor
2015-11-26 13:26:41.379 DEBUG [localhost-startStop-1] '/move' >> Move1TaskService.move(...) : void | @Ok(json:full) @Fail(json:full) | by 0 Filters | (I:UTF-8/O:UTF-8)
2015-11-26 13:26:41.384 INFO [localhost-startStop-1] Found 1 module methods
2015-11-26 13:26:41.390 DEBUG [localhost-startStop-1] @Localization not define
2015-11-26 13:26:41.395 INFO [localhost-startStop-1] Setup application...
2015-11-26 13:26:41.401 DEBUG [localhost-startStop-1] Get 'quartzService'<class cn.calensoft.service.QuartzService>
2015-11-26 13:26:41.407 DEBUG [localhost-startStop-1] >> Load definition
2015-11-26 13:26:41.421 DEBUG [localhost-startStop-1] Found IocObject(quartzService) in IocLoader(AnnotationIocLoader@932113858)
2015-11-26 13:26:41.426 DEBUG [localhost-startStop-1] >> Make...'quartzService'<class cn.calensoft.service.QuartzService>
2015-11-26 13:26:41.439 DEBUG [localhost-startStop-1] class cn.calensoft.service.QuartzService without AOP
2015-11-26 13:26:41.447 DEBUG [localhost-startStop-1] Save object 'quartzService' to [app]
2015-11-26 13:26:41.456 DEBUG [localhost-startStop-1] Get TypeParams for self : cn.calensoft.bean.QuartzTask
2015-11-26 13:26:41.494 DEBUG [localhost-startStop-1] Get 'dao'<>
2015-11-26 13:26:41.501 DEBUG [localhost-startStop-1] >> Load definition
2015-11-26 13:26:41.503 DEBUG [localhost-startStop-1] Loading define for name=dao
2015-11-26 13:26:41.516 DEBUG [localhost-startStop-1] Found IocObject(dao) in IocLoader(JsonLoader@851187397)
2015-11-26 13:26:41.526 DEBUG [localhost-startStop-1] >> Make...'dao'<>
2015-11-26 13:26:41.595 DEBUG [localhost-startStop-1] class org.nutz.dao.impl.NutDao without AOP
2015-11-26 13:26:41.597 DEBUG [localhost-startStop-1] Save object 'dao' to [app]
2015-11-26 13:26:41.598 DEBUG [localhost-startStop-1] Get 'dataSource'<>
2015-11-26 13:26:41.602 DEBUG [localhost-startStop-1] >> Load definition
2015-11-26 13:26:41.609 DEBUG [localhost-startStop-1] Loading define for name=dataSource
2015-11-26 13:26:41.658 DEBUG [localhost-startStop-1] Found IocObject(dataSource) in IocLoader(JsonLoader@851187397)
2015-11-26 13:26:41.664 DEBUG [localhost-startStop-1] >> Make...'dataSource'<>
2015-11-26 13:26:41.796 DEBUG [localhost-startStop-1] class com.alibaba.druid.pool.DruidDataSource without AOP
2015-11-26 13:26:41.799 DEBUG [localhost-startStop-1] Save object 'dataSource' to [app]
SLF4J: Failed to load class "org.slf4j.impl.StaticLoggerBinder".
SLF4J: Defaulting to no-operation (NOP) logger implementation
SLF4J: See http://www.slf4j.org/codes.html#StaticLoggerBinder for further details.
2015-11-26 13:26:41.950 DEBUG [localhost-startStop-1] Get 'conf'<>
2015-11-26 13:26:41.956 DEBUG [localhost-startStop-1] >> Load definition
2015-11-26 13:26:41.956 DEBUG [localhost-startStop-1] Loading define for name=conf
2015-11-26 13:26:41.963 DEBUG [localhost-startStop-1] Found IocObject(conf) in IocLoader(JsonLoader@851187397)
2015-11-26 13:26:41.967 DEBUG [localhost-startStop-1] >> Make...'conf'<>
2015-11-26 13:26:41.972 DEBUG [localhost-startStop-1] class org.nutz.ioc.impl.PropertiesProxy without AOP
2015-11-26 13:26:41.973 DEBUG [localhost-startStop-1] Save object 'conf' to [app]

7 回复

把ioc配置中conf的那段贴出来看看

@wendal 没有放在ioc配置的那个包 我是放在源代码根目录下的

我是说ioc里面conf那个bean的配置信息贴出来, 例如nutz,cn写的是

		conf : {
			type : "org.nutz.ioc.impl.PropertiesProxy",
			fields : {
				paths : ["custom/"]
			}
		},

@wendal QQ截图20151126134409_png
我是有一个 配置文件叫 conf 应该和这个没关系

又是截图, 严重警告一次

原因是 这个

paths : ["/"]

肯定死得很惨啦, 改成相对路径就可以了

添加回复
请先登陆
回到顶部